Event
Details
Part of the Hartford Track Club's Winter Race Series, the Colchester
Half Marathon marked its 18th annual running in February of 2009, when
more than 300 runners crossed the finish line on a day when
temperatures were in the 40s and the weather was more cooperative than
in some recent years, when wintry weather including ice, snow and sleet
have fallen on the day of the race.
Known for its challenging hills along the rolling New England
countryside surrounding the town, the Colchester Half follows an
out-and-back loop course that starts and finishes at Bacon Academy on
Norwich Street. From there, runners follow a clockwise route along
sections of Norwich, Windham Avenue, Goshen Hill Road and McCall Road.
Though most of the race unfolds along paved country roads, a roughly
three mile stretch of the race takes runners along dirt roads, where
they'll need to be careful of ice and/or snow if inclement weather is
in the forecast.
The last few miles of the race take runners along Roger Foot Road and
back onto Norwich Avenue, where they run the final stretch back in to
the finish line at the high school. After the finish, the race
organizers host a post-race "carbo re-loading" party at Colchester's
Farmers Club on Halls Hill Road, which lies about a half-mile from the
race start/finish line.

Weather & Climate
Located in the central part of the state, about 25 miles southeast of
Hartford and roughly 25 miles from Connecticut's Atlantic coastline,
the town of Colchester typically experiences cold (and sometimes
bitterly
cold) conditions in the late winter season, and usually sees
its driest weather of the year in the month the race is held. In
February, the town's average monthly temperatures range between
38°F and 15°F, while precipitation amounts average
about 3 inches for the month.
